As for the sealing of the Cape Road, it was part finished when we were up there in June. They were starting at the Cape end and sealing back towards Waitiki Landing. They are probably at least half way by now (although construction will have been slower over the winter.) Expect around 10km of gravel riding, some of which would be pretty challenging with a pillion on board (loose rocks the size of tennis balls!)
The nearest accommodation to the Cape is a camping ground at Waitiki Landing, and I believe there is a backpacker's hostel at Pukenui (about 60km south of the Cape). There is also a backpackers and other accommodation in Kaitaia.
